BR-CL-25:Endpoint identifier scheme identifier MUST belong to the CEF EAS code list
An Endpoint Identifier scheme is not a valid CEF EAS code. EAS codes identify electronic address types for PEPPOL routing.
Why This Error Matters
Invoice rejected. Endpoint schemes are required for electronic delivery routing.
Common Causes
- Endpoint scheme ID not from CEF EAS code list
- EndpointID schemeID uses non-standard identifier
- Electronic address scheme not in EAS list
- Custom endpoint scheme not mapped to CEF EAS
- SchemeID format incorrect for endpoint identifier
